A few minor updates before the BCA National.
Had the wiper motor rebuilt by https://rebuildingtricowipers.com/ Fickens was lighting fast I had the motor back in my hands with in 7 days of sending it out. Beside that being impressive he called me and gave me a detailed run down of what all he did on this one (and another one I sent him).
The radio has also gone out to be redone by an old family friend. He did the radio in my 80C and the 69 Charger.
Still waiting for the block... hopefully when I get back from the National... and still waiting on the media blaster, but no timeline there which is disappointing.
